Filter

Sort by

🎉 3-Year Anniversary Sale! Buy One, Get One Free! 🎁

Add two of your favorite polo shirts to the cart, and pay for only one!

This deal is available for a limited time only!

Sale price From $46.95
Regular price $56.95
Sale price From $46.95
Regular price $56.95
Sale price From $46.95
Regular price $56.95
Sale price From $46.95
Regular price $56.95
Sale price From $46.95
Regular price $56.95
Sale price From $46.95
Regular price $56.95
Sale price From $46.95
Regular price $56.95
Sale price From $46.95
Regular price $56.95
Sale price From $46.95
Regular price $56.95
Sale price From $46.95
Regular price $56.95
Sale price From $46.95
Regular price $56.95
Sale price From $46.95
Regular price $56.95
Viewing 36 of 141 products
{ } { }